Isi kandungan:

Lihat Monitor Bersiri Melalui Bluetooth: 4 Langkah
Lihat Monitor Bersiri Melalui Bluetooth: 4 Langkah

Video: Lihat Monitor Bersiri Melalui Bluetooth: 4 Langkah

Video: Lihat Monitor Bersiri Melalui Bluetooth: 4 Langkah
Video: Bluetooth Audio Receiver Tools 2024, November
Anonim
Lihat Monitor Bersiri Melalui Bluetooth
Lihat Monitor Bersiri Melalui Bluetooth

Projek ini menggunakan modul Bluetooth HC-05 untuk menggantikan sambungan berwayar tradisional yang digunakan untuk melihat monitor bersiri.

Bahan:

  • Arduino -
  • Papan Roti -
  • Wayar pelompat -
  • Modul Bluetooth HC-05 -

Langkah 1: Kod

Kod ini adalah contoh komunikasi bersiri sederhana yang diambil dari contoh yang disediakan di Arduino IDE. Anda boleh menemuinya di: Fail> Contoh> Komunikasi> Jadual Ascii

/*

Jadual ASCII Mencetak nilai bait dalam semua format yang mungkin: - sebagai nilai binari mentah - sebagai nilai perpuluhan, heksa, oktal, dan binari yang dikodkan ASCII Untuk lebih lanjut mengenai ASCII, lihat https://www.asciitable.com dan https:// www.asciitable.com Litar: Tidak memerlukan perkakasan luaran. dibuat tahun 2006 oleh Nicholas Zambetti <https://www.asciitable.com> diubah suai 9 Apr 2012 oleh Tom Igoe Kod contoh ini berada dalam domain awam. https://www.asciitable.com * / batal persediaan () {Serial.begin (9600); sambil (! bersiri) {; // tunggu port bersambung. Diperlukan untuk port USB asli sahaja} Serial.println ("ASCII Table ~ Character Map"); } int iniByte = 33; gelung kosong () {Serial.write (thisByte); Serial.print (", dec:"); Serial.print (ThisByte); Serial.print (", hex:"); Serial.print (thisByte, HEX); Serial.print (", oct:"); Serial.print (ThisByte, OCT); Serial.print (", bin:"); Serial.println (ThisByte, BIN); jika (thisByte == 126) {sementara (benar) {teruskan; }} ThisByte ++; }

  • Pastikan kadar baud anda ditetapkan ke 9600
  • Hampir semua kod yang menggunakan sambungan bersiri ke komputer akan berfungsi, tetapi ini hanyalah contoh mudah.

Langkah 2: Litar

Litar
Litar

Setelah kod telah dimuat naik ke papan, putuskan bekalan kuasa. Seterusnya, Pasang modul Bluetooth ke litar seperti yang dilihat di atas:

  • GND ke Tanah
  • Pin VCC hingga 5v
  • TXD untuk pin 0
  • RXD ke pin 1

Langkah 3: Sambungan Bluetooth

Sambungan Bluetooth
Sambungan Bluetooth
Sambungan Bluetooth
Sambungan Bluetooth
Sambungan Bluetooth
Sambungan Bluetooth
  1. Kuasa Arduino
  2. Buka tetapan Bluetooth komputer anda
  3. Pasangkan dengan modul HC-05
  4. Cari nama port bersiri modul dalam "peranti dan pencetak":
  5. Di Arduino IDE, pilih port bersiri modul Bluetooth (milik saya adalah COM10)
  6. Buka monitor bersiri seperti biasa untuk melihat maklumat masuk

Langkah 4: Langkah Lebih Lanjut

Berikut adalah beberapa perkara pilihan yang mungkin anda ingin mencuba:

  • Anda boleh menggunakan port bersiri maya sebagai gantinya, tetapi saya dapati menggunakan yang sebenarnya berfungsi jauh lebih pantas (dan biasanya lebih mudah).
  • Anda juga boleh menggunakan proses ini dengan contoh Firmata standard untuk membolehkan kawalan tanpa wayar dengan Pemprosesan (tetapkan kelajuan ke 9600 terlebih dahulu)

Disyorkan: